Lead, Clinical Pharmacology, Immunology

What Youโ€™ll Do
- Provide clinical pharmacology expertise to program and study teams throughout a moleculeโ€™s lifecycle.
- Represent clinical pharmacology on development programs; identify opportunities for modeling and simulation to advance understanding of pharmacological activity, efficacy, and safety.
- Develop and implement the clinical pharmacology development plan (strategic, scientific, translational, clinical).
- Define key milestones/decisions; identify risks and mitigation strategies.
- Lead execution of clinical pharmacology studies/analyses; interpret results and recommend actions.
- Conduct hands-on quantitative analysis and present findings to multidisciplinary teams.
- Author/revise clinical pharmacology sections of key documents.
- Serve as subject matter expert for interactions with Health Authorities.
- Align with cross-functional partners, consultants, experts, and vendors; deliver approved timelines.
- Maintain current knowledge of regulatory practices and quantitative/clinical pharmacology methodology.

Qualifications
- PhD or MD/PhD in Pharmacology, Pharmacokinetics, Pharmaceutics, PharmD, or related field.
- 5+ years relevant industry experience (clinical pharmacology and/or clinical PK/PD).
- Ability to analyze/interpret PK and PK/PD data.
- Experience designing/implementing elements of clinical studies and/or clinical pharmacology studies.
- Knowledge of and ability to apply regulatory/ICH guidelines for clinical pharmacology data.
- Hands-on experience with QSP models and/or population PK, PK/PD, exposure-response analyses.
- Proficiency with PK/PD tools (Phoenix, R, NONMEM); Monolix/MATLAB a plus.
- Excellent oral and written communication skills.
